Yes, you can get a central scholarship in Max Institute of Allied and Paramedical Education, but it depends on your caste, domicile, or income. The institute itself provides admission based on merit and need for aid. Therefore, you can talk to the admissions department for any kind of fee relief.

Diploma at Max Institute of Allied and Paramedical Education, Lucknow is two years long. The institute offers five specialisations in the programme, which are Medical Laboratory Technology, Radiology Technician, Operation Theatre Technician, Dialysis Technician and Cardiac Technology.
